How Our Team Actually Works for Bathroom Water Damage Restoration

A proper restoration process is crucial to preventing further damage and ensuring your safety. Our team uses a combination of equipment and science to get the job done right. We’ll contain the affected area, use moisture meters to detect hidden water, and set up drying protocols to prevent mold and mildew growth.

Step 1: Containment

We’ll isolate the affected area to prevent further damage and contamination. Our crew will set up a containment system to ensure your property remains safe and secure.

Step 2: Moisture Detection

We’ll use advanced moisture meters to detect hidden water and identify areas that need drying. This ensures we catch all the damage and prevent future problems.

Step 3: Drying and Evaporation

We’ll use industrial-grade fans and dehumidifiers to evaporate excess moisture and speed up the drying process. This step is crucial to preventing mold and mildew growth.

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fecting

We’ll thoroughly clean and disinfect all affected areas, including walls, floors, and surfaces. This ensures your bathroom is safe and healthy for you and your family.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Touch-ups

We’ll conduct a final inspection to ensure all damage has been addressed. Any necessary touch-ups or repairs will be completed to get your bathroom looking like new.

Warning Signs You Need Bathroom Water Damage Restoration

Ignoring these signs can lead to costly repairs and even health risks. Don’t wait until it’s too late. Catch these signs early and save yourself the headache.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

A musty smell in your bathroom is a clear indication of mold and mildew growth. This can lead to serious health problems, including respiratory issues and allergic reactions. Don’t ignore the smell; address it immediately.

Water Stains and Discoloration

Water stains and discoloration on walls, ceilings, and floors are clear signs of water damage. This can lead to costly repairs and even structural issues. Don’t wait; address the problem now.

Warping and Buckling

Warping and buckling of flooring and walls are clear indications of water damage. This can lead to structural issues and even collapse. Don’t wait; address the problem now.

Bathroom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When to Call a Pro

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small leak, contained area Yes No DIY is usually effective for small, contained areas.
Large leak, extensive damage No Yes Professional help is necessary for large, extensive damage to prevent further problems.
Mold and mildew growth No Yes Mold and mildew growth need professional attention to prevent health risks.
Structural issues No Yes Structural issues need professional attention to prevent collapse and further damage.
Water damage under flooring No Yes Water damage under flooring needs professional attention to prevent further damage and costly repairs.
Discoloration or warping of surfaces No Yes Discoloration or warping of surfaces need professional attention to prevent further damage and costly repairs.

Bathroom Water Damage Restoration Cost in Tomball, TX

The cost of Bathroom Water Damage Restoration varies based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Tomball, TX. Prices can range from $500 to $2,500 or more, depending on the extent of the damage and the materials required to restore your bathroom to its former glory. We’ll provide a free, on-site assessment to find out the exact cost of the restoration process.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Containment and Moisture Detection $500-$1,500 The size of the affected area and the complexity of the containment process.
Drying and Evaporation $1,000-$3,000 The size of the affected area and the number of fans and dehumidifiers required.
Cleaning and Disinfecting $500-$1,000 The size of the affected area and the level of cleaning required.
Final Inspection and Touch-ups $200-$500 The extent of the damage and the number of touch-ups required.
Structural Repairs $1,000-$5,000 The extent of the structural damage and the materials required for repairs.
Antimicrobial Treatment $200-$500 The size of the affected area and the level of antimicrobial treatment required.

Common Questions About Bathroom Water Damage Restoration

Will Insurance Cover Bathroom Water Damage Restoration?

Yes, insurance may cover Bathroom Water Damage Restoration. Check your policy to see what’s covered and what’s not. Our team will work with your insurance company to ensure a smooth claims process.

How Long Does Bathroom Water Damage Restoration Take?

The restoration process typically takes 3-5 days, depending on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. We’ll work around the clock to get you back on track as soon as possible.

Is Bathroom Water Damage Restoration a Health Risk?

Yes, Bathroom Water Damage Restoration can be a health risk if not handled properly. Mold and mildew growth can lead to respiratory issues, allergic reactions, and other health problems. Our team takes safety precautions seriously and will ensure your bathroom is safe and healthy for you and your family.

What Causes Bathroom Water Damage?

Bathroom water damage can be caused by a variety of factors, including leaks, overflows, and poor drainage. Regular maintenance and inspections can help prevent bathroom water damage.

How Can I Prevent Bathroom Water Damage?

Prevention is key with bathroom water damage. Regularly inspect your bathroom for signs of damage, fix leaks quickly, and ensure proper drainage and ventilation. Our team can provide you with tips and recommendations for preventing bathroom water damage.
